‘Lotus Tower’ to receive grand investment!

Date:

An investment deal was entered between Singapore-based Kreate Design Pte Limited and the Nelum Kuluna (Lotus Tower) Company in Company yesterday (18), hoping the establishment of a full equipped amusement park even featuring the famous water pool games inside the premises.

These establishments are expected to be completed within a period of six months.

Joining the occasion, State Minister of Tourism Diana Gamage revealed that this will be the biggest investment yet received to Sri Lanka, allowing the country to receive US $ 01 billion within the next two-to-three years, whilst the establishments will also allow the reception of investment greater than that.
